1945 Citroen 15 vs. 1994 Mitsubishi 3000GT

To start off, 1994 Mitsubishi 3000GT is newer by 49 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1945 Citroen 15.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1945 Citroen 15 would be higher. At 2,970 cc (6 cylinders), 1994 Mitsubishi 3000GT is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1994 Mitsubishi 3000GT (221 HP @ 6000 RPM) has 145 more horse power than 1945 Citroen 15. (76 HP @ 3800 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 1994 Mitsubishi 3000GT should accelerate faster than 1945 Citroen 15.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1994 Mitsubishi 3000GT weights approximately 151 kg more than 1945 Citroen 15.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Because 1994 Mitsubishi 3000GT is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 1945 Citroen 15.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 1994 Mitsubishi 3000GT will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1994 Mitsubishi 3000GT (280 Nm @ 4500 RPM) has 93 more torque (in Nm) than 1945 Citroen 15. (187 Nm @ 2000 RPM). This means 1994 Mitsubishi 3000GT will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1945 Citroen 15.

Compare all specifications:

1945 Citroen 15 1994 Mitsubishi 3000GT
Make Citroen Mitsubishi
Model 15 3000GT
Year Released 1945 1994
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 2866 cc 2970 cc
Engine Cylinders 6 cylinders 6 cylinders
Engine Type in-line V
Valves per Cylinder 2 valves 4 valves
Horse Power 76 HP 221 HP
Engine RPM 3800 RPM 6000 RPM
Torque 187 Nm 280 Nm
Torque RPM 2000 RPM 4500 RPM
Fuel Type Gasoline Gasoline
Drive Type Front 4WD
Transmission Type Manual Manual
Vehicle Weight 1325 kg 1476 kg
Vehicle Length 4770 mm 4570 mm
Vehicle Width 1800 mm 1850 mm
Vehicle Height 1570 mm 1290 mm
Wheelbase Size 3100 mm 2480 mm
